<h3>About the Community</h3> <p>Tucson sits in the Sonoran Desert at roughly 2,400 feet elevation, delivering mild winters, abundant sunshine, and immediate access to world-class hiking in Saguaro National Park, Mount Lemmon, and the Santa Catalina Mountains. The city blends a vibrant arts and dining scene — anchored by the University of Arizona — with a cost of living meaningfully lower than Phoenix, Los Angeles, or Denver. Families benefit from strong public and private school options, and outdoor enthusiasts find year-round recreation ranging from trail running and cycling to birding in the nearby Sky Island ranges.</p>
